DESCRIPTION
The QEC12X is an 880 nm AlGaAs LED encapsulated in a clear purple tinted, plastic T-1 package.
QEC121
QEC122 QEC123
FEATURES
= 880 nm
Chip material = AlGaAs
Package type: T-1 (3mm lens diameter)
Matched Photosensor: QSC112/113/114
Narrow Emission Angle, 16
High Output Power
Package material and color: Clear, purple tinted, plastic

NOTES
1. Derate power dissipation linearly 1.33 mW/C above 25C.
2. RMA flux is recommended.
3. Methanol or isopropyl alcohols are recommended as cleaning agents.
4. Soldering iron
1/16"
(1.6mm) minimum from housing.
